Job Description:

***:Under the general supervision of the Sport Development Coordinator, and the technical direction and guidance of the Neighbourhood Lead, is responsible for assisting in developing rapport with, and acting as a support for, neighbourhood residents. Works with the Healthy Kids HOME Program Coordinator (Thunder Bay District Health Unit) and Neighbourhood Lead to develop and implement programming; liaise with community organizations, project partners, Neighbourhood Leads, and fellow Neighbourhood Program Coordinators.

MAJOR R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Collaborates with Neighbourhood Lead to plan and implement neighborhoodbased recreation programs that will engage priority neighbourhood families.
  • Collaborates with local organizations to schedule and implement programming within priority areas of nutrition, physical activity, and tobacco control or other health promotion areas.
  • Assists with connecting families with community services and programs.
  • Develops and maintains relationships with other service providers in the community.
  • Works closely with staff from other priority neighborhood sites to assist in developing and sharing resources.
  • Recruits and engages participants to programs and Healthy Kids sites by building trusting relationships and learning about the families who live in the priority neighbourhoods, including through outreach activities such as doorknocking.
  • Plans and implements food programs such as community meals, community kitchens and access to emergency food in collaboration with relevant service providers.
  • Provides safe and fun environment for children to play in during adult programs. Implements appropriate behavior management strategies as needed.
  • Assists in preparing and monitoring Healthy Kids sites, including securing necessary supplies and equipment, identifying needs for alterations, maintenance or repair, conducting safety inspections; ensuring that rules and regulations are followed with respect to staff, service providers, and participants.
  • Plans and implements recreational activities at events and during programming.
  • Adheres to procedures and operational manuals as needed.
  • Assists with data collection, gathers feedback regarding community needs and assets, and maintains documentation required for program evaluation.
  • Participates in regular meetings with City of Thunder Bay Sport Development Coordinator, Healthy Kids HOME Program Coordinator, Neighbourhood Leads and other Neighbourhood Program Coordinators and Planning Team, and attends other relevant meetings when requested.
  • Performs other related duties as may be assigned.
